of Different kind, are daily expecd to take of these a very dense part never yet been brought to England many articles may & probably do therefore Lay unknown in that Country the easily to be Released that could prove if once their nature was investigated of infinite to the Commerce of India to the manufactory of this Country & Possibly to the wealth of the People
Two one instances may be mentiond that has very Recently taken Place An article generaly usd in India under the name of [Aitch?] & which is there Sold at a very cheap rate was by the utmost accident observed to resemble by Foster that Principle in oak bark which its virtue for Tannery Resides experiments were immediately made & Chemical Proof given produced that a given Quantity of this Substance containd as much of the Tannery Principle at 9 or 10 times its weight of oak bark & on enquiry it appeard probable that the Tanners in England may be supplied with the Tannery Principle by the importation of this Article from india far cheaper than they they now purchase it from the Fellers of oak Timber a dis in which case Leather will be renered cheaper & oak Trees be Less Liable to be Felld in an immature State than they now are When the Bark of an oak tree is worth more than half the value of the Timber it Covers in consequence of of this information being given to the Court of Directors orders have been given for the importation of this article which is expected by the next Ships
